At the Mercy of the Common Noise: Blow-ups in a Conditional McKean--Vlasov Problem

Sean Ledger, Andreas Sojmark

Published 2018-07-13Version 1

We extend a model of feedback and contagion in large mean-field systems by introducing a common source of noise driven by Brownian motion. Although the dynamics in the model are continuous, the feedback effect can lead to jump discontinuities in the solutions --- i.e. 'blow-ups'. We prove existence of solutions to the corresponding conditional McKean--Vlasov equation and we show that the pathwise realisation of the common noise can both trigger and prevent blow-ups.
